Synonym
Oxolamine; BRN 0527181; SKF 9976 [as citrate]; Bredon; Ossolamina; AF 438; AF-438; AF438; 683 M;
IUPAC/Chemical Name
N,N-diethyl-2-(3-phenyl-1,2,4-oxadiazol-5-yl)ethan-1-amine
InChi Key
IDCHQQSVJAAUQQ-UHFFFAOYSA-N
InChi Code
InChI=1S/C14H19N3O/c1-3-17(4-2)11-10-13-15-14(16-18-13)12-8-6-5-7-9-12/h5-9H,3-4,10-11H2,1-2H3
SMILES Code
CCN(CCC1=NC(C2=CC=CC=C2)=NO1)CC
